SubjectRe: [PATCH] UAPI: include <asm/byteorder.h> in linux/raid/md_p.h
On Tue, 29 Oct 2013 13:28:58 +0100 Aurelien Jarno <aurelien@aurel32.net>
wrote:

> linux/raid/md_p.h is using conditionals depending on endianess and fails
> with an error if neither of __BIG_ENDIAN, __LITTLE_ENDIAN or
> __BYTE_ORDER are defined, but it doesn't include any header which can
> define these constants. This make this header unusable alone.
>
> This patch adds a #include <asm/byteorder.h> at the beginning of this
> header to make it usable alone. This is needed to compile klibc on MIPS.
>
> Signed-off-by: Aurelien Jarno <aurelien@aurel32.net>
> ---
> include/uapi/linux/raid/md_p.h | 1 +
>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
>
> diff --git a/include/uapi/linux/raid/md_p.h b/include/uapi/linux/raid/md_p.h
> index fe1a540..f7cf7f3 100644
> --- a/include/uapi/linux/raid/md_p.h
> +++ b/include/uapi/linux/raid/md_p.h
> @@ -16,6 +16,7 @@
> #define _MD_P_H
>
> #include <linux/types.h>
> +#include <asm/byteorder.h>
>
> /*
> * RAID superblock.

Makes sense. Applied. Thanks.
